About the role
We are looking for a Project Controls Manager to join our Rio Tinto Projects team to lead the project controls function for the Winu Feasibility Study and following notice to proceed Project Execution. The role will be based in Perth and will require travel to the project site on a regular basis during execution.
This role is a great opportunity to lead and motivate the Project Controls team, provide technical advice and support to Project Director, Study Manager and the broader Project Services team.
Reporting to the Senior Manager Project Services, you will be responsible for:
Partnering with Project Management to deliver the project controls function and deliverables through the study and execution phases
Leading project controls personnel to deliver timely and accurate cost and schedule information to project management to enable mitigations or to pursue opportunities
Managing project controls processes and ensuring compliance with Rio Tinto Projects systems, policies and procedures
Preparing and validating project reports, as well as regular auditing of project controls reporting, cost and schedule status
Working with and supporting Package Owners and Area Managers to ensure package progress and cost forecasts are accurate
Execution Estimate and Schedule delivery, review and presentations to senior management
Stakeholder Management within the study, project and wider Rio Tinto business
About you
To be considered for this role, you will have:
15+ years of hands-on experience in Project Controls attained within a major project environment
Previous success in leading and developing a team of Project Controls professionals
Familiarity with project, project controls and procurement systems (e.g., SAP, PM+, SharePoint, Unifier, Primavera P6).
Experience working with Contracts and Procurement project teams to align on contracting strategies, budget allocations, forecasting and claims assessment
Excellent communication and collaboration skills to build effective relationships with internal and external stakeholders
Degree qualification in Engineering or Business/Commerce or similar
It will also be beneficial if you have:
Project controls experience across multiple project delivery models – EPCM, Owner Execute, Integrated Teams etc
